NCV70522DQ
Micro-Stepping Motor Driver
Introduction
The NCV70522DQ is a microâstepping stepper motor driver for
bipolar stepper motors. The chip is connected through I/O pins and a
SPI interface with an external microcontroller. The NCV70522DQ
features an internal currentâtranslation table: it takes the next
microâstep depending on the clock signal on the stepping input pin
(NXT) and the status of the direction register or input pin (DIR). A
reliable current control is achieved using an integrated proprietary
PWM algorithm.
The NCV70522DQ includes a soâcalled âSpeed and Load Angleâ
(SLA) output, allowing the creation of stall detection algorithms and
control loops to adjust torque and speed based on the motorâs back
electromotive force (BEMF).
The NCV70522DQ is implemented in I2T100 technology, enabling
both high voltage analog circuitry and digital functionality on the
same chip. The device is fully compatible with automotive voltage and
temperature requirements and suited to general purpose stepper motor
applications in the automotive, industrial, medical and marine
domains.
Features
⢠Dual HâBridge for 2 Phase Stepper Motors
⢠Programmable PeakâCurrent up to 1.2 A Continuous (1.5 A Short
Time), Using a 5âBit Current DAC
⢠OnâChip Current Translator
⢠SPI Interface
⢠Speed and LoadâAngle Output
⢠7 Step Modes from FullâStep up to 32 MicroâSteps
⢠Fully Integrated CurrentâSense
⢠PWM Current Control with Automatic Selection of Fast and Slow
Decay
⢠Low EMC PWM with Selectable Voltage Slopes
⢠Active Flyâback Diodes
⢠Full Output Protection and Diagnosis
⢠Thermal Warning and Shutdown
⢠Digital IOâs Compatible with 5 V and 3.3 V Microcontrollers
⢠Integrated 5 V Voltage Regulator to Supply an External
Microcontroller
⢠Integrated Reset Function to Reset External Microcontroller
⢠Integrated Watchdog Function
⢠NCV Prefix for Automotive and Other Applications Requiring Site
and Control Changes
